7 Side Effects of Weight Loss Diet Pills

The prospect of losing weight by taking in a few pills everyday might seem interesting and tempting to many who have been trying to lose weight but in vain.

It is true that some of the prescribed weight loss pills may work by inhibiting appetite or burning fat but many research works have proved that most of the weight loss diet pills have several side effects associated with them and that they can be dangerous to the health of a person.  The following are the 7 major side effects that weight loss diet pills can result in:

1. One of the major side effects of a weight loss diet pill is that it can cause diarrhea, bloating and gas. This is more so the case in those diet pills which work as fat blockers and work by removing excess of the fat through the intestines.

2. Another side effect of consumption of a weight loss diet pill on a regular basis is that it can raise the blood pressure and also affect the heart rate. Those diet pills which work as appetite suppressants tend to stimulate the sympathetic nervous system and hence have this effect on the body.

Due to increase in heart rate, the risk of cardiac arrest increases especially in the case of those who have already been suffering from a heart issue or the problem of raised blood pressure.

3. Some of the less serious or minor side effects of taking weight loss pills include headaches, constipation, the problem of dry mouth and even insomnia. Insomnia is caused because some of the chemicals present in diet pills can affect the sleep pattern of a person

4. Addiction is another side effect of consumption of weight loss diet pills.  Most of the diet pills contain amphetamines apart from anti-depressants and anti-anxiety chemicals which are known to be highly addictive.

5. Another side effect of a weight loss pill or a diet pill is that it can cause moodiness in the person. If you consume these diet pills regularly, you may become irritate quickly and will experience mood swings often.

6. Some other side effects include dizziness, restlessness, fatigue, runny nose and sore throat.

7. Some diet pills which result in absorption of fat soluble vitamins can cause risk of kidney stones and gallbladder stones. These weight loss diet pills also cause oily stools as well as flatulence.
